  • After uninstall, cleanup and install both the gameforge client and the game.

    Press Start in the launcher:



    Does not work, but what is it telling me?

    A file is being opened?


    Experiment: Place an empty file with name 'NoCheckVersion' in the game client map, and then press Start again:


    So it is accessing this file in the game client map.

    But does it make any sense?


    It looks like it is trying to call the client with NoCheckVersion parameter, but for some reason the parameter is not passed to the client but instead interpreted as a file name.


    Btw. the system is running Windows 7.

  • Cenre, already tried that and indeed it works as you explained. It gives the old login screen, but no chance to login since all game accounts are already moved to GF account.


    But I succeeded to solve it nevertheless. Guess what? Somewhere else on my PC is another client.exe present, which has nothing to do with Gameforge or Runes of Magic.


    And the launcher decided to NOT call the correct Client.exe in the game map, but instead to call the client.exe somewhere else.


    Removed the other client.exe and suddenly the launcher finds the correct Client.exe in the game map.


    IMO this is a bug: the launcher should only look in the game map!
